SOLAR ENERGY Solana provides a major step forward for solar in Arizona Solana Generating Station is one of the largest solar plants of its kind in the world. That’s great news not only for the APS customers who are benefiting from this clean energy source, but also because of the jobs created by Solana and other solar-related businesses.
